About This Item

London, J. Mulvy Ouseley & Son, Ye Olde Royaltie Booke Publishers, 1913 1st. Hardback, 9 x 6.5 inches. Grey cloth with black lettering and black and red pictorial illustration to front. Top page edges gilt. In very good condition. Handling marks/small ink spots to rear board and rear edge of spine. Some minor rubbing to spine ends and corners. Partial tanning to free leaves of endpapers. Page edges rough/uncut. Else pages and plates all very clean and tight. Else a very good clean and tight copy. 150pp. Illustrated with 46 Full-Page B&W plates by Zoffany Oldfield.

About The Antique Map & Bookshop

The Antique Map & Bookshop was established in 1976 and has been in Puddletown since 1978. PUDDLETOWN is situated just outside DORCHESTER in the county of DORSET, on the A35 to BOURNEMOUTH. The village has a by-pass now which means there is easy access to the village and ample space for parking. Our shop is directly on the main road through the village.
